Smart: Fits into tight places

In conjunction with the opening of the 2010 Canadian International Autoshow, Smart Canada has come up with a creative guerilla campaign. They’ve placed a giant shoehorn behind a Smart fortwo visually illustrating that the less than 3 metre smart fortwo can park almost anywhere.
The display, parked in various high traffic downtown locations, also imparts the message: “Fits into tight places”.



Company: Smart
Agency: BBDO, Toronto
